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Using Event-B for Critical Device Software Systems

Buy

Defining a new development life-cycle methodology, together with a set of associated techniques and tools to develop highly critical systems using formal techniques, this book adopts a rigorous safety assessment approach explored via several layers (from requirements analysis to automatic source code generation).

This is assessed and evaluated via a standard case study: the cardiac pacemaker. Additionally a formalisation of an Electrocardiogram (ECG) is used to identify anomalies in order to improve existing medical protocols. This allows the key issue - that formal methods are not currently integrated into established critical systems development processes - to be discussed in a highly effective and informative way.

Using Event-B for Critical Device Software Systems serves as a valuable resource for researchers and students of formal methods. The assessment of critical systems development is applicable to all industries, but engineers and physicians from the health domain will find the cardiac pacemaker case study of particular value.

(HTML tags aren't allowed.)

Microsoft Visual C++ Windows Applications by Example
Microsoft Visual C++ Windows Applications by Example
With this book you will learn how to create applications using MDI, complex file formats, text parsing and processing, graphics, and interactions. Every essential skill required to build Windows desktop-style applications is covered in the context of fully working examples.

The book begins with a quick primer on the C++ language, and
...
Strabismus Surgery and its Complications
Strabismus Surgery and its Complications
Strabismus Surgery and its Complications is divided into two distinct sections. Part I outlines the surgical management of strabismus in 17 chapters. A full range of topics is covered including basic anatomy and physiology, surgical planning, preoperative and postoperative management, and surgical techniques. Surgical...
Building Web Applications with Python and Neo4j
Building Web Applications with Python and Neo4j

Develop exciting real-world Python-based web applications with Neo4j using frameworks such as Flask, Py2neo, and Django

About This Book

  • Develop a set of common applications and solutions with Neo4j and Python
  • Secure and deploy the Neo4j database in production
  • A step-by-step...

Microsoft Windows Azure Development Cookbook
Microsoft Windows Azure Development Cookbook

The Windows Azure Platform is Microsoft's Platform-as-a-Service environment for hosting services and data in the cloud. It provides developers with on-demand compute, storage, and service connectivity capabilities that facilitate the hosting of highly-scalable services in Windows Azure datacenters across the globe.

This...

SamsTeachYourself TweetDeck
SamsTeachYourself TweetDeck

Do you like to tweet? Or follow other people’s tweets? Are you a heavy Facebook user? Do you like to follow your favorite entertainers on MySpace? Do you network with other business professionals on LinkedIn? If you engage in one or more of these activities, you know how time consuming the whole social networking thing can be. This is...

HP Vertica Essentials
HP Vertica Essentials

Learn how to deploy, administer, and manage HP Vertica, one of the most robust MPP solutions around

About This Book

  • Learn cluster management and techniques to improve performance in Vertica
  • Deploy local segmentation and get to grips with the concept of projections
  • A simple,...
©2021 LearnIT (support@pdfchm.net) - Privacy Policy